发表评论取消回复
相关阅读
相关 Java多线程并发问题:共享资源案例分析
在Java多线程并发中,共享资源是常见且复杂的问题。下面以一个典型的共享资源(如数组)案例进行分析: 1. **问题描述**: - 线程A和线程B同时对同一个数组进行操
相关 Java多线程并发问题:共享资源竞争案例
在Java多线程并发编程中,经常会遇到"共享资源竞争"的问题。以下是一个典型的例子: 案例:生产者消费者模型(Producer-Consumer Problem) 场景:有
相关 Java多线程并发编程:共享资源问题案例
在Java多线程并发编程中,共享资源问题是一个常见的挑战。以下是一些案例: 1. **饥饿问题(星饿)**: 在一个生产者-消费者模型中,如果生产者没有及时提供数据给消
相关 Java多线程编程:共享资源问题案例
Java多线程编程中,共享资源问题是一个常见的问题,主要涉及到线程安全和数据一致性。以下是一些常见的共享资源问题案例: 1. **竞态条件(Race Condition)**
相关 Java多线程并发编程:共享资源问题
在Java的多线程并发编程中,共享资源问题是非常常见的。共享资源可以是变量、数组、静态类变量、文件等。 1. 数据不一致:多个线程同时修改一个共享资源可能导致数据不一致。解决
相关 Java多线程并发编程:共享资源的锁问题案例
在Java多线程并发编程中,共享资源的锁问题是经常遇到的问题。以下是一个简单的例子: ```java import java.util.concurrent.locks.Lo
相关 Java多线程并发编程:共享资源引发的问题案例
在Java多线程并发编程中,共享资源引发的问题主要包括竞态条件、死锁和活锁等。 1. 竞态条件: 当多个线程访问并修改同一块内存区域时,可能会出现不一致的结果。例如,两
相关 Java多线程并发编程:共享资源问题实例
在Java多线程并发编程中,共享资源问题是常见的挑战。下面是一个具体的实例: **问题描述:** 假设有一个名为`countdown`的类,它有一个整型变量`count`用于
相关 Java多线程并发编程:共享资源冲突案例
在Java多线程并发编程中,共享资源的冲突是一个常见的问题。以下是一个具体的例子: **案例:银行存款系统** 假设有一个简单的银行存款系统,它有多个窗口供客户存款。每个窗
相关 多线程并发编程:Java的共享资源问题
在Java的多线程并发编程中,共享资源问题是常见的挑战。以下是一些关于共享资源问题的详细解释: 1. 数据竞争(Race Condition):多个线程同时访问和修改同一份数
还没有评论,来说两句吧...